Claims
- 1. A deployable antenna system to be mounted on a support surface for storage in a stowed position and for operation in a deployed position, said deployable antenna system comprising:
- a reflector having a face, a focal point, a proximal portion adjacent said support surface, and a distal portion that is remote from said support surface when said antenna system is deployed;
- a feed horn for receiving electrical signals reflected by said reflector;
- azimuth control means for rotating said reflector in an azimuth direction with respect to said support surface; and
- elevation control means coupled to said azimuth control means and to said reflector for raising said reflector in an elevational direction, having:
- (a) means on said support surface for providing translational movement along said support surface;
- (b) means connected to said providing means at a predetermined fixed position and to said reflector for pivoting said reflector as said reflector moves between said stowed position and said deployed position; and
- (c) means slideably engaging said providing means and connected to said reflector for adjustably controlling the position of said providing means along said support surface, thereby moving said reflector between said stowed position and said deployed position.
- 2. The antenna system of claim 1 wherein said support surface comprises the roof of a vehicle.
- 3. The antenna system of claim 1 wherein antenna system further comprises:
- a feed frame having a base portion pivotally attached to said reflector and a distal portion supporting said feed horn, said feed frame stowing said feed horn beneath said reflector in said stowed position and moving said feed horn to said focal point when not in said stowed position; and
- a feed pivot arm connected to said feed frame having a first end pivotally attached to said reflector and a distal end which contacts a portion of said antenna system as said reflector reaches its stowed position to pivot said feed frame about its base portion and stow said feed horn adjacent to said face of said reflector.
- 4. The antenna system of claim 1 wherein said azimuth control means comprise:
- a stationary ring mounted to said roof;
- an azimuth ring supported by said stationary ring for rotation about an azimuth axis; and
- drive means for selectively rotating said azimuth ring to a desired orientation about said azimuth axis.
